Michael Stewart Stuhlbarg (born July 5, 1968) is an American actor. He rose to prominence as troubled university professor Larry Gopnik in the 2009 dark comedy film A Serious Man, directed by Joel ...

by Stephen King
In the sequel to "The Shining", Dan Torrance is now an adult who helps a young, powerful girl named Abra. Rose the Hat and her cult called "The True Knot" are also out to get Abra for her powers.
